TOO BAD: POLICEMAN..2 OTHERS ELECTROCUTED IN MINNA

 This is just too bad. A Police officer identified as Abu Gani and two other people identified as Saidu Shehu, a father and his son Gambo, were electrocuted after a newly installed transformer malfunctioned and caused a power upsurge in Minna, the Niger State capital yesterday February 21st. 

There was a fire outbreak due to the power upsurge. The victims were rushed to the Minna General Hospital where they were confirmed dead...



POLICE ARRESTS GANG THAT ROBBED ON-LINE RETAIL STORE JUMIA IN FESTAC

The Lagos State Police Command on Friday, February 19 paraded three members of the gang that allegedly looted N1.2 million in cash, phones, laptops and clothes that from the Festac branch of popular online retailer, Jumia on October 29, 2015.

The gang was smashed following a tip-off received by the Special Intelligence Bureau (SIB) that a member of the gang identified as Ogaga Pemu had arranged with someone to service his operational German pistol and also provide magazines for the weapon, The Nations reports.

According to Pemu, who was arrested at Joe Baddy Hotel in Mende, Maryland, Yohanna who worked for JUMIA provided his gang information on the company in exchange for N200,000.

"We were six that participated in the robbery. Myself, Daniel the store keeper and his older brother, Hosea. Don Domie, Chris and another guy. We got N1.2million. I gave Hosea N400,000 for him and his brother. Their share was N200,000 each. I took N250,000, gave Don and Chris N200,000 each and gave the other guy who was a new person N150,000. That operation was my fourth. I was arrested first and then I told the police how to get them and they were also arrested. But the other members have fled."

Lagos State Police Commissioner, Fatai Owoseni who paraded the suspects said two locally made pistols, two cartridges, a locally-made magazine with two .9mm live ammunition and a laptop were recovered from the gang, adding that investigation was ongoing to arrest the absconded members.


'WE NEVER ASKED OLISE FOR MONEY IN EXCHANGE FOR GOOD ARTICLES' -SWAN

The Sports Writers Association of Nigeria (SWAN) has described Super Eagles coach Sunday Oliseh as a pathological liar who doesn't have the integrity to lead the National team and who always looks for excuses to justify his incompetence as the Super Eagles coach. This comes on the back of a 7-day ultimatum given by the body to the Super Eagles coach after he alleged that some journalists approached him to ask for monetary favour in exchange for good articles and stories written about him.


“Sunday Oliseh has displayed to the whole world that he does not have the capability of being trusted with the Senior National Team of a great football playing nation like Nigeria and lacks the integrity whatsoever as an individual to continue to parade himself as the head coach of the Super Eagles,”the statement signed by the Associations Secretary General read. 

Over a week ago the Sports Writers body released this statement;

"Our attention has been drawn to a recent statement credited to the Head Coach of the Super Eagles Mr.Sunday Ogochukwu Oliseh that some members of the Sports Writers Association of Nigeria (SWAN) have been approaching him requesting for money to enable them write favourable reports for him, and that some are acting as agents requesting that he invites certain players to camp so that they can do business with them. 

"The leadership of the Sports Writers Association of Nigeria (SWAN) in its quest to ensure continous sanity in the profession, and for the purpose of the change mantra which is gradually revolving round every aspect of the economy, is requesting that the Head Coach names these journalists that approached him within the next seven days. "This has become imperative considering the recent bashing the Sports Writers have been receiving from the NFF and its employees.

It would be recalled that the NFF President only recently at the National Assembly took a swipe on the Sports Writers for being the brain behind their inabilities to secure sponsors for the Federation.'' "Henceforth, SWAN would no longer fold its arms and watch people blame their misfortune on the Association. We have, as major stakeholders, contributed positively to the development of sports in the country, and would no longer tolerate people dragging SWAN in their maladministration technical ineptitude. "We remain committed to sports development in Nigeria."

WOMEN IN KADUNA STATE RUSH TO SELL THEIR GOLD AS THE PRICE RISES !

Women in Kaduna state are reportedly storming the gold sellers section of the Kaduna Central Market as the price of gold per gram rises to N10, 500 as against the N8,000 old price due to the continuous fall of the Naira against international currencies.

According to 
Daily Ttust, many of the women in the state have over the last one week besieged the gold sellers section of the state main market to sell off their gold so they can make some huge profits.

One of the gold merchants in the market. Rabiu Ismaila Funtuwa, said the old price for selling was N8,200 while buying was N9,000. He attributed the rush to sell gold to the increase in the price of selling to N10,500 and buying N13,500.

“We have received so many women in the market in the past few days due to increase in the price for selling‎. I just hope they make good use of the money. If they are going to help themselves by buying houses or plots of land, it will go a long way in easing their problems and that of their families,” he said.

Another gold seller, Alhaji DanBorno said, “I have bought over 20 sets of gold from different women who came to sell because the price suddenly went up last week. Hajiya Jamila Ayuba who sold her gold recently said “I quickly rushed to the market to sell my gold so that I can finish my house which I have been unable to complete since the death of my husband"she said
